nfq wrote:
DrHell wrote:
How do Tasers or encoders do, for having the video in HD?
HD sucks for 2D games that have low resolutions like 320x240, better just encode with the normal in-game resolution, it looks better, is much easier to encode, and doesn't waste as much space and bandwidth on youtube.
Yeah, but for being the resolution so low, YouTube will ruin all the quality. And DrHell, this is my way to encode, but you need Sony Vegas. Just if you are interested: http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=6rD_dDRTC4I I still stands that you should use AviSynth.
